Financial Manager
Morgan Family Foundation Position Description Location: Yellow Springs, Ohio Summary: The Financial Manager oversees the Morgan Family Foundation’s monetary resources with respect to administration and grantmaking. The financial manager is primarily responsible for the quarterly financial statements; budgeting; cash flow management for operational activities; and various financial analyses and projections. This position reports to the executive director. Responsibilities: Financial Management - Supervise preparation of quarterly financial statements
- Create annual budget draft and incorporate revisions as needed
- Report on and analyze variances in operating budget
- Project cash needs and facilitate cash transfers
- Aid in calculation of minimum payout on rolling basis, investigate possible move to different methodology for determining grants budget other than minimum required payout
- Prepare special reports as needed/requested (5-year financial plans, cash flows, projections, etc.)
- Provide a financial assessment of grantseekers’ applications and/or grantees’ reports as requested by program officers or the executive director
- Develop and oversee maintenance of written policies and procedures regarding the foundation’s financial management
- Manage work with outside accounting firm on agreed-upon procedures
- Other duties as assigned
Desired Qualifications/Experience: - Bachelor’s degree in accounting, finance, business administration, or a related field; advanced degree a plus
- Minimum of four years work experience in financial administration or accounting, preferably in the nonprofit sector
- Excellent communication skills, particularly the ability to translate and teach financial concepts
- Excellent people skills, including the ability to work effectively and respectfully with the board, staff, representatives of nonprofit organizations and professional colleagues
- Solid computer skills, particularly in QuickBooks, Excel, Word and Outlook (email)
- Self-motivated, highly dependable, excellent attention to detail
- Able to work independently and as part of a team
- Confidentiality
- Ability to go up and down a flight of steps with paperwork; occasional air and car travel
Staff position is estimated to be ~0.40 FTE with high variability of hours required throughout year.
